Transaction 595942f3c30ebc565b59234972058e493058ba8f2f8c9394fc0b7daa22e05f5e
1 Input
1 Output
-
595942f3c30ebc565b59234972058e493058ba8f2f8c9394fc0b7daa22e05f5e:0
- value
- 181513
- script pubkey
- OP_0 OP_PUSHBYTES_20 3e441ed965a70104c0a28bb6fab58a6b91805124
- address
- bc1q8ezpakt95uqsfs9z3wm04dv2dwgcq5fylayu83